Australia’s largest multi-disciplinary cycling festival will be back in Brisbane this year. One may look forward to catching the action of track national championships, free community rides, thrilling mountain bike rides, and 50 other supporting events if they are based at one of the Brisbane hotels the likes of iStay River City Brisbane during the festival, which is held from the 24th March to 12th April 2021.
During this exciting festival, one may look forward to experiencing the festival village at the Brisbane showgrounds, which will be featuring action-packed cycling entertainment along with an active lifestyle expo. This festival will also invite locals and visitors to become a part of it with special programmes such as ‘Flavours of the Festival’, ‘Wheely Fun School Holiday Camp’, ‘Bike Film Night’, and ‘Corporate Ride Week’.
